335 Rodriguez Street, Watsonville CA

335 Rodriguez Street, Watsonville CA

Developer Novin Development Corp.
Service Provider TBD.
Property Management TBD.
Development Type Five-story, type III modular new construction.
Site Area 1.33 Acres
Density 113 units/acre
Development Profile Total of 150 units, including:

  • 40 units of Studio @ 400 sf
  • 30 units of 1BR @ 670 sf
  • 40 units of 2BR @ 800 sf
  • 40 units of 3BR @ 1,050 sf
Amenities Garage and surface parking, retail spaces
Resident Profile TBD
Funders TBD
Architect AO Architects

335 Rodriguez Street is an upcoming five-story, 150-unit affordable housing development in the heart of downtown Watsonville. Developed by Novin Development Corp. and designed by AO Architects, the project will offer a mix of studio, one-, two-, and three-bedroom units built using modular construction on a 1.33-acre infill site. The building will include garage and surface parking, as well as ground-floor retail to activate the street and serve residents and the broader community.

The site is located in a designated Disadvantaged Community under SB 535 and sits within a transit-rich, walkable area surrounded by jobs, services, and local amenities. Its location and design make it a strong candidate for AHSC funding, supporting the City’s efforts to bring more affordable housing to the downtown core while promoting sustainable, community-oriented development.
